Output 1679050def144669124bc9cc78f7e609f3ba62b31ce3e7669ae70e96b6b174b3:3

value
21699056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a0cc369fac695e3199675b7ef37f4e51e2de0d OP_EQUAL
address
3Lz18SWWhWRsWZXkMrMrQ3cFqN6hXMj2AS
transaction
1679050def144669124bc9cc78f7e609f3ba62b31ce3e7669ae70e96b6b174b3
spent
true